No. ASW planes will have an alternate mode to act as non-spotting pseudo fighters, which you can place manually and engage incoming CV squads. If tagged, they will deal small damage, increase the AA damage dealt to the squad and prevent it from spotting. While this sounds great because "CV bad", this will not affect all ships and all CVs equally, as not all ships have ASW planes and not all CVs are reliant on staying around a target, such as russian CVs, which also includes the other change in AA mechanics they mentioned, in which the AA damage is not dealt to the reserve group, but potentially (based on chance/RNG) the attacking one, making it theoretically possible to reduce or prevent a strike of non-russian CVs. One one hand, players should be more capable of defending themselves against CVs if they anticipate strikes, yet CVs can potentially drain ASW cooldowns and as a player attacked by a sub and a CV, you are only given the chance to defend against one. For russian CVs, little to nothing changes, while IJN and basically everyone else will be nerfed. This is also an indirect buff to submarines and makes DDs even more of a CV target, due to the lack of ASW planes. Overall, a questionable change with good intentions, but at the moment and from the article alone, there are too many unclear aspects, so the PTS will show what they cooked up this time.

They are okay, since you have a 12% chance of getting a premium CV, yet it is a gamble and locks you out of Brisbane or the pirate mommy milkers captain if you go all in. The problem with the crates is, that you get 14 for the price of Brisbane, 17 in total with all the resources and without spending dubs, but only a guaranteed drop at 20. Yes, you can buy more tokens for dubs but this is only cost effective or in this case "not a double gamble" when your first 1000 dubloon package is the 350 tokens, otherwise you keep gambling and hope for the 350 package or 1-3 (out of 5) consecutive 50 token packages to appear, cutting the possible savings into a minimum of only 2300 dubs. This allows you to ignore the event but get a guaranteed premium CV. All regular premium CVs are available for dubs and range from 6300 to 14'000 in price, so you are saving a minimum of 5300 dubs when you have the 350 token package as your first. I say "regular premium CV" because they dont drop Enterprise or Löwenhardt. If collecting is your main concern, get the captain with tokens, Brisbane later with resources and gamble all other tokens on the CVs, which you can just cash out anyways, as the captain has not been announced to return in later iterations, while Brisbane is destined to appear for coal later. How much later we dont know, still no Velos for coal either and they said the same about her. tl;dr: You are only "saving" dubloons if you get lucky. If you dont own Bearn and Ark Royal, dont do it, unless your first visible 1000 dub package is the 350 token drop. If you already own Bearn and Ark Royal but miss any T8 CV, dont do it, unless your first visible 1000 dub package is the 50 token drop or higher, you save a minimum of 300 dubs.
